This is a gutshot of an express clone. This is not the final leadress or finished amp. This is a pic from the initial startup before I tidy everything up for minimal floor noise. The express is very sensitive to layout and wire location which I do after the initial build and prior to it leaving my shop. This amp actually had quite a bit of work done to it after this pic.
